## Configuration

Bramblefox uses a shared connection pool for all reads against the ledger database. Pool sizing is controlled by POOL_MIN and POOL_MAX in the service env file; defaults are safe for local work. The pooler itself authenticates to the upstream proxy separately from the app, so its env file must also include the following line.

sealed setting: ARCHIVE_KEY3=8d0

## Who to ping about GiftNote

Welcome aboard! GiftNote is our donation-receipt mailer for the Larchfield Fund. Template tweaks go to the comms folks; delivery failures and bounce weirdness go to the platform crew. Don't push template changes on Fridays — receipts batch over the weekend. For anything GiftNote-related, start with the address below.

billing contact of kaweg-tajeg = drudor.lamion.oliath@torvalabs.test

### Runbook: Report export timezone mismatches (Glimmerfield)

If a customer reports that exported totals differ from the dashboard, check whether their report schedule predates the March cutover — older schedules still render in server-local time rather than the account timezone. Re-saving the schedule fixes it. Before escalating, confirm the export worker is running with the expected timezone settings shown below.

config for kadup-kajog:
[raldor]
host = raldor.tolvaqworks.internal
user = raldor_svc
database = raldor_prod